public class RedisClusterContainer extends Object implements RedisCommandsInstanceContainer
Container for managing JedisCluster.
Note that JedisCluster doesn’t need to be pooled since it’s thread-safe and it stores pools internally.Constructor and Description |
---|
RedisClusterContainer(redis.clients.jedis.JedisCluster jedisCluster)
Constructor.
|
Modifier and Type | Method and Description |
---|---|
void |
close() |
RedisCommands |
getInstance()
Borrows instance from container.
|
void |
returnInstance(RedisCommands redisCommands)
Returns instance to container.
|
public RedisClusterContainer(redis.clients.jedis.JedisCluster jedisCluster)
Constructor.
jedisCluster
- JedisCluster instancepublic RedisCommands getInstance()
Borrows instance from container.
getInstance
in interface RedisCommandsInstanceContainer
public void returnInstance(RedisCommands redisCommands)
Returns instance to container.
returnInstance
in interface RedisCommandsInstanceContainer
redisCommands
- borrowed instancepublic void close() throws IOException
close
in interface Closeable
close
in interface AutoCloseable
IOException
Copyright © 2019 The Apache Software Foundation. All rights reserved.